Two unbeaten sides go head to head in the late kick-off on Saturday as recently relegated Sunderland take on Leeds at the Stadium of Light. Simon Grayson’s start to life in the north-east has been successful given the doubts that were lingering around the club before the season. His side have come through difficult tests against Derby, Norwich and Sheffield Wednesday without defeat and they will be looking to make serious progress now that the season is up and running.

Meanwhile, Leeds, now managed by Thomas Christiansen have been solid if unspectacular at the beginning of this campaign. They were part of a thrilling opening day clash against Bolton which they won 3-2 away, but two 0-0’s in a row at Elland Road have quashed the early excitement emanating from West Yorkshire. If they can repeat their opening day performance on their travels here they could shock Sunderland.

Stat Zone

Sunderland

  • No win in last 11 home league games (D5 L6).
  • Appointed Simon Grayson in June – he was in charge of Preston for over 4 years – league record: P198 W84 D67 L47. Won 1 promotion.
  • Signed Lewis Grabban on loan - 3 goals in 3 league apps this season.

 Leeds

  • 1 win in last 8 league games (D5 L2).
  • Appointed Thomas Christiansen – Record P4 W2 D2. League record: P3 W1 D2.
  • Chris Wood has scored 28 goals in his last 45 league apps.

H2H - Not met in league since 2006-07, Sunderland won last 2 league meetings without conceding.

Prediction: Leeds have looked incredibly tight defensively whereas Sunderland have been more expansive in the early stages. Both sides may take a draw and keep their unbeaten records. Three stalemates in a row for Leeds. Sunderland 0-0 Leeds
